9182 | Ancient names like 'Obadiah' depend on tradition, not on where the name originated [Dummett] |
Full Idea: In the case of 'Obadiah', associated only with one act of writing a prophecy, ..it is the tradition which connects our use of the name with the man; where the actual name itself first came from has little to do with it. | |
From: Michael Dummett (Frege's Distinction of Sense and Reference [1975], p.256) | |
A reaction: Excellent. This seems to me a much more accurate account of reference than the notion of a baptism. In the case of 'Homer', whether someone was ever baptised thus is of no importance to us. The tradition is everything. Also Shakespeare. |

14279 | Asking 'If p, will q?' when p is uncertain, then first add p hypothetically to your knowledge [Ramsey] |
Full Idea: If two people are arguing 'If p, will q?' and are both in doubt as to p, they are adding p hypothetically to their stock of knowledge, and arguing on that basis about q; ...they are fixing their degrees of belief in q given p. | |
From: Frank P. Ramsey (Law and Causality [1928], B 155 n) | |
A reaction: This has become famous as the 'Ramsey Test'. Bennett emphasises that he is not saying that you should actually believe p - you are just trying it for size. The presupposition approach to conditionals seems attractive. Edgington likes 'degrees'. |
6894 | Mental terms can be replaced in a sentence by a variable and an existential quantifier [Ramsey] |
Full Idea: Ramsey Sentences are his technique for eliminating theoretical terms in science (and can be applied to mental terms, or to social rights); a term in a sentence is replaced by a variable and an existential quantifier. | |
From: Frank P. Ramsey (Law and Causality [1928]), quoted by Thomas Mautner - Penguin Dictionary of Philosophy p.469 | |
A reaction: The technique is used by functionalists and results in a sort of eliminativism. The intrinsic nature of mental states is eliminated, because everything worth saying can be expressed in terms of functional/causal role. Sounds wrong to me. |
9181 | The causal theory of reference can't distinguish just hearing a name from knowing its use [Dummett] |
Full Idea: The causal theory of reference, in a full-blown form, makes it impossible to distinguish between knowing the use of a proper name and simply having heard the name and recognising it as a name. | |
From: Michael Dummett (Frege's Distinction of Sense and Reference [1975], p.254) | |
A reaction: None of these things are all-or-nothing. I have an inkling of how to use it once I realise it is a name. Of course you could be causally connected to a name and not even realise that it was a name, so something more is needed. |
9418 | All knowledge needs systematizing, and the axioms would be the laws of nature [Ramsey] |
Full Idea: Even if we knew everything, we should still want to systematize our knowledge as a deductive system, and the general axioms in that system would be the fundamental laws of nature. | |
From: Frank P. Ramsey (Law and Causality [1928], §A) | |
A reaction: This is the Mill-Ramsey-Lewis view. Cf. Idea 9420. |
